What happens if someone tries to do an electronic withdrawal on a closed bank acct.?
I moved to a new city and closed my bank account. I had a few things that were taken out electronically and I've cancelled all of them, but I know from past experience that sometimes that doesn't always work and companies claim they never received the order to cancel the electronic withdrawal and keep doing them. Maybe I'm just being pessimistic, but I always expect the worst when it comes to this kind of stuff. I know I don't have any uncashed checks out, but what happens if a company tries to make an electronic withdrawal from my account after the account is closed? Will it just not go through or will I be penalized in some way for this (penalized by the bank, not the company trying to withdrawal money)?
